Siddhanth Kapoor, son of Bollywood actor Shakti Kapoor and brother of Shraddha Kapoor, was arrested and detained in Bengaluru. Police accused Shiddhant on drugs possession. According to the report, the Bangalore police raided the hotel on Sunday evening. From there, they took Shiddhant on custody. Siddhant’s drug test was also positive. After a robbery at a hotel on MG Road, police tested 35 people, and reports from several people, including Siddhanta, were positive. The police do not want to specify at this time whether the suspects came to the hotel with drugs or whether they had drugs in the middle of the party. Siddhant Kapoor, seen in movies like ‘Haseena Parker’ and ‘Chehre’, is Shraddhy Kapoor’s brother. Previously, Central Narcotics Bureau (NCB) summoned Shraddha Kapoor to investigate the drug case of Sushant Singh Rajput. Recently, Shahrukh Khan’s son Aryan Khan was imprisoned in a similar case.
